Mr.Navin Kumar Pandey ====================================================== CORAM: HONOURABLE MR. JUSTICE SHIVAJI PANDEY ORAL ORDER 02-03-2020 Heard learned counsel for the petitioner and learned counsel for the State.

In this case, the petitioner is apprehending his arrest in connection with Dalsinghsarai P.S. Case No. 325 of 2019 registered for offences under sections 30(a) of the Bihar Prohibition and Excise Act, 2016.

As prosecution case, on suspicion, the policy party intercepted a Maruti Alto 800 vehicle and recovered 24.390 litre foreign liquor from the same but, all the three accused persons fled away from there.

The petitioner has got no criminal antecedent as has been stated in paragraph no.3 of the present bail application. Looking to the quantity of liquor recovered as also
